MARTINEZ-LOPEZ, Aída; CERVANTES-DUARTE, Rafael; REYES-SALINAS, Amada  y  VALDEZ-HOLGUIN, José Eduardo. Cambio estacional de clorofila a en la Bahía de La Paz, B. C. S., México. Hidrobiológica [online]. 2001, vol.11, n.1, pp.45-52. ISSN 0188-8897.

From April 1993 to March 1995 hourly wind data, intensity and direction, were analyzed. Monthly sampling of temperature, Secchi disc depth and chlorophyll a were carried out on 5 stations transect across the Bahía de La Paz at surface, 10 and 25 meters depth. Southward winds were dominant during October to March and northward the rest of the year. The highest temperatures were registered from July to October with temperatures between 28 and 32 °C, and the lowest from January to March, with values in the range of 20 and 22 °C. Maximum Secchi depths (14-24 m) was observed during July through November and minimum during January to June (6-15 m). Chlorophyll a concentration showed an inverse relationship with temperature and water transparency. The lowest integrated chlorophyll a values (<10 mg m-2) were found at warm season as a result probably of a strong water column stratification and slow vertical transport of dissolved and particulate materials from deep layers. Maximum values (142.8 mg m-2) during cold season were associated with water column mixing processes and nutrient availability in the euphotic zone.

Palabras llave : Chlorophyll a; phytoplankton; transparency; seasonal change; Bahía de La Paz; Mexico.
